Produced by Peter Wilson (The Jam, Martha and the Muffins) / Includes original 1st version of "Independence Day" / "Waiting for a Miracle" is the debut studio album by the English post-punk band The Comsat Angels, released in 1980. This record is considered a landmark in the post-punk and new wave genres, showcasing the band's atmospheric and moody sound that blends sharp guitar work, melodic basslines and introspective lyrics with a sense of emotional depth. The Comsat Angels' sound on this album is often compared to contemporaries such as Joy Division and Echo & the Bunnymen, but it possesses a unique, melancholic edge. The album includes the original version of "Independence Day," which is darker and rawer than the more polished and slightly pop-oriented re-recording featured on their 1983 album "Land".
